Fiserv Subsidiary BBVA Compass Adds Person-to-Person Payment Option With ZashPay

BBVA Compass announced that it is offering the ZashPay person-to-person payment service from Fiserv, Inc. FISV. "BBVA Compass is excited to be able to offer ZashPay to our customers," said Andy Hernandez, director of channel development for BBVA Compass. "We are committed to offering solutions that match the way our customers live today, providing them with increased ease and convenience in managing their money. An important and growing segment of our customers are demanding payment options that help them simplify their lives. With ZashPay supporting our Simple Personal Payments(SM) service we have responded to this demand, expanding the functionality of our customers' online banking experience by making everyday personal financial tasks quicker and easier." With Simple Personal Payments in place, BBVA Compass customers can send money easily to anyone with a U.S. bank account using only the recipient's e-mail address or mobile number. The payment is deducted directly from the sender's banking account and deposited into the recipient's account. Payments made using the system are delivered in as little as one business day.
